UNION COMPANY’S LINE,

The Kahika arrived at Gre.vmouth yesterday from Westport to complete her loading for Wellington. The Kaituna arrived at Greymouth yesterday from Auckland and after discharging inward cargo loads timber for Sydney. The Ivanna left Greymouth yesterday for Auckland via Westport. The Raimai arrived at Greymouth early- this morning from Wellington to load for the. same port. The Gabriella left Greymouth yesterday afternoon for Melbourne, timber laden.

The Ngatoro left Greymouth yesterday opening arriving at Greymouth tomorrow morning to load for Miramar. The Ramona is due at Greymouth on Saturday from Auckland to load for Wellington.
